Autor Wątek: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ane  (Przeczytany 14519 razy)

0 użytkowników i 1 Gość przegląda ten wątek.

Offline Apoc

  • Nowy użytkownik
  • *
  • Wiadomości: 5
  • Reputacja +0/-0
  • Wersja programu: GT + Nexo
Zauważyłem, że Nexo w dziwny i nieprzemyślany sposób drukuje dane z kolumny "ilość" - łączy ją razem z jednostką miary - wcześniej nie zwracałem na to uwagi, ale utknąłem na tym tuż po przeniesieniu danych z GT.
W samym programie nie da się tego zmienić.
I tu pojawia się pytanie: czy komuś udało się tak przerobić wzorzec wydruku faktury sprzedaży, żeby pole "ilość" zwracało jedynie wartość liczbową, bez jednostki miary? Krótko mówiąc chciałbym uzyskać w polu "ilość" na wydruku wartość wyrażoną liczbą (np. 10) zamiast kombinacji ilości i jednostki miary (np. 10 szt.) - jednostkę miary chciałbym mieć w oddzielnej kolumnie "j.m" - vide załączone obrazki.

Dostaję na wydruku to:
http://postimg.org/image/7yhqp712h/

A chciałbym mieć to, tylko w kolumnie "ilość" bez "sztuk":
http://postimg.org/image/gfcpg02cn/

Offline Chris

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 2850
  • Reputacja +275/-0
  • Wersja programu: GT, Nexo - aktualne
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#1 dnia: Styczeń 07, 2016, 22:26:18 »
Wystarczy zmienić "Expression" pola Ilość na {Dokument.Pozycje.encjaPozycji.Ilosc}, ewentualnie jeszcze pod siebie sformatować.
Krzysztof, Radom

Offline candy

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 4871
  • Reputacja +172/-11
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#2 dnia: Styczeń 07, 2016, 22:56:47 »
Chyba że to Subiekt nexo, a nie Subiekt nexo PRO, to wtedy raczej lipa  :(
Nie pytaj co rząd może zrobić dla Ciebie. Spytaj czy mógłby tego nie robić.

Offline Chris

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 2850
  • Reputacja +275/-0
  • Wersja programu: GT, Nexo - aktualne
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#3 dnia: Styczeń 08, 2016, 17:52:14 »
Chyba że to Subiekt nexo, a nie Subiekt nexo PRO, to wtedy raczej lipa  :(
Można upgrade kupić :)
Krzysztof, Radom

Offline Apoc

  • Nowy użytkownik
  • *
  • Wiadomości: 5
  • Reputacja +0/-0
  • Wersja programu: GT + Nexo
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#4 dnia: Styczeń 11, 2016, 06:33:43 »
Dziękuję Chris za podpowiedź - mam wersję Pro, ale... patrzę na ten wzorzec i póki co ciemność widzę:/

Offline Chris

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 2850
  • Reputacja +275/-0
  • Wersja programu: GT, Nexo - aktualne
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#5 dnia: Styczeń 11, 2016, 12:07:18 »
Dziękuję Chris za podpowiedź - mam wersję Pro, ale... patrzę na ten wzorzec i póki co ciemność widzę:/
Ale nie widzisz pola ilość, czy monitor się popsuł  ;) ?
Krzysztof, Radom

Offline Apoc

  • Nowy użytkownik
  • *
  • Wiadomości: 5
  • Reputacja +0/-0
  • Wersja programu: GT + Nexo
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#6 dnia: Styczeń 11, 2016, 17:44:20 »
Dziękuję Chris za podpowiedź - mam wersję Pro, ale... patrzę na ten wzorzec i póki co ciemność widzę:/
Ale nie widzisz pola ilość, czy monitor się popsuł  ;) ?

Monitor działa świetnie;-) Oczy działają świetnie;-) Mózg nie działa świetnie, bo nie ogarniam - patrzę na ten wzorzec i kompletnie nie mogę zrozumieć, co miałeś na myśli... To zawstydzające, ale najwidoczniej poziom mojej elementarnej wiedzy mocno odbiega od Waszego:\

Offline Chris

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 2850
  • Reputacja +275/-0
  • Wersja programu: GT, Nexo - aktualne
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#7 dnia: Styczeń 11, 2016, 20:52:24 »
Spróbuję w punktach, bo mi się screenów nie chce robić:
1) Na liście wzorców wydruku zaznaczasz ten do poprawy i klikasz "Popraw wzorzec"
2) Klikasz na pole "Raport  strona dodatkowa"
3) Zaznaczasz pole w tabeli "Towary: Data Source: 1" ,w drugiej kolumnie, w piątym rzędzie prawym klawiszem myszy i klikasz polecenie "Design"
4) Zmieniasz to co tam jest na:
{Format(Dokument.FormatWalutyDokumentu, Dokument.Pozycje.encjaPozycji.Cena.NettoPrzedRabatem)}
Krzysztof, Radom

Offline birds22

  • Ekspert
  • *****
  • Wiadomości: 9208
  • Reputacja +1304/-21
  • Wersja programu: Najnowsza
« Ostatnia zmiana: Styczeń 11, 2016, 21:04:38 wysłana przez birds22 »
Sławek, Zduńska Wola

Offline Chris

  • Zaawansowany użytkownik
  • ****
  • Wiadomości: 2850
  • Reputacja +275/-0
  • Wersja programu: GT, Nexo - aktualne
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#9 dnia: Styczeń 11, 2016, 21:04:55 »
Krzysiek - w czwartym punkcie nie to pole :)
Jak nie to jak to, tylko nie to trzeba tam zamieścić, ale to co wcześniej podawałem.
Krzysztof, Radom

Offline Apoc

  • Nowy użytkownik
  • *
  • Wiadomości: 5
  • Reputacja +0/-0
  • Wersja programu: GT + Nexo
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#10 dnia: Styczeń 11, 2016, 21:21:52 »
Panowie, rozwiązanie zamieszczone przez Sławka zadziałało świetnie. Gdybym jeszcze miał pojęcie dlaczego...
Wyrażenie {Format("{0:N2}", Dokument.Pozycje.encjaPozycji.Ilosc)} - zwraca pole liczbowe. Wcześniejsza zmiana powodowała komunikat o niemożliwości dokonania jakiejś tam konwersji.

DZIĘKUJĘ WAM BARDZO!
Mam jeszcze jedną prośbę - jako, że średnio lubię czuć się jak dureń, podpowiedzcie mi proszę, gdzie na temat raportów czy edycji wzorców mogę doczytać na tyle dużo, żebym miał w przyszłości pojęcie, o czym mowa, zamiast wygłupiać się ze swoją niewiedzą...?

Offline birds22

  • Ekspert
  • *****
  • Wiadomości: 9208
  • Reputacja +1304/-21
  • Wersja programu: Najnowsza
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#11 dnia: Styczeń 11, 2016, 21:24:12 »
Jeszcze nie zacząłem, ale pewnie tu:
https://www.stimulsoft.com/en/documentation

:)

BTW:
Nie przesadzaj z tą samokrytyką - nie da się wiedzieć wszystkiego. Ale możesz próbować ;)
« Ostatnia zmiana: Styczeń 11, 2016, 21:31:34 wysłana przez birds22 »
Sławek, Zduńska Wola

Offline Robert84

  • Nowy użytkownik
  • *
  • Wiadomości: 1
  • Reputacja +0/-0
  • Wersja programu: nexo pro
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#12 dnia: Styczeń 23, 2022, 20:21:58 »
Spróbuję w punktach, bo mi się screenów nie chce robić:
1) Na liście wzorców wydruku zaznaczasz ten do poprawy i klikasz "Popraw wzorzec"
2) Klikasz na pole "Raport  strona dodatkowa"
3) Zaznaczasz pole w tabeli "Towary: Data Source: 1" ,w drugiej kolumnie, w piątym rzędzie prawym klawiszem myszy i klikasz polecenie "Design"
4) Zmieniasz to co tam jest na:
{Format(Dokument.FormatWalutyDokumentu, Dokument.Pozycje.encjaPozycji.Cena.NettoPrzedRabatem)}

Mam ten sam problem, niestety utknąłem na drugim puncie.... nie mogę znaleźć tej opcji.
Bardzo proszę o pomoc

Offline dmbski

  • Nowy użytkownik
  • *
  • Wiadomości: 6
  • Reputacja +1/-0
  • Wersja programu: GratyfikantGT, RewizorGT, Subiekt Nexo (Pro)
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#13 dnia: Luty 05, 2022, 11:33:57 »
Akurat przygotowywałem zrzuty do instrukcji to przesyłam jak to ustawić.
Wchodzimy do poprawy wzorca jak podano powyżej. W programie, który się otworzy Designer, po prawej stronie, na dole paska ustawień obiektów, odnajdujemy 1 Report Tree i wybieramy. Rozwijamy następnie strukturę pól do interesującego nas pola.
Załącznik 1

Dwuklik na wierszu z wybranym polem otworzy okno edytora wyrażeń (i ustawi stronę Designera na odpowiednią).
Wprowadzamy/edytujemy nazwę źródła danych dla pola.
Załącznik 2
Na końcu zapisujemy.


Forum Użytkownikow Subiekt GT

Odp: pola "ilość" i "ilość w podstawowej jednostce" zwracają te same dane
« Odpowiedź #13 dnia: Luty 05, 2022, 11:33:57 »